#461c61 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#461c61 is composed of 27.5% red, 11% green and 38%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.8% cyan, 71.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 62% black. It has a hue angle of 276.5 degrees, a saturation of 55.2% and a lightness of 24.5%. #461c61 color hex could be obtained by blending #8c38c2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

#461c61 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#461c61 has RGB values of R:70, G:28, B:97 and CMYK values of C:0.28, M:0.71, Y:0,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 4594785.

Shades and Tints of #461c61
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040206 is the darkest color, while #faf5f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#461c61
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3f3e3f is the less saturated color, while #4b0479 is the most saturated one.
